Our Retail and Hospitality Litigation Services

We handle a broad range of premises liability cases, including slip and fall accidents due to wet floors, ice, or uneven surfaces; injuries from defective railings, staircases, or walkways; falling merchandise or unsecured items in stores; improper building maintenance or lighting; elevator or escalator malfunctions; swimming pool or spa-related injuries; and injuries caused by negligent security or inadequate supervision.

Our attorneys assist with employment contracts, workplace policies, severance agreements, and non-compete enforcement. We also represent employers before state and federal agencies and offer training on harassment, discrimination, and wage compliance.

We represent retail and hospitality clients in commercial leasing, property acquisitions, and development matters. Our attorneys advise on lease negotiation, landlord-tenant relationships, zoning, and land use.

We assist with franchise agreement drafting, compliance, renewals, and dispute resolution. Our attorneys understand the legal nuances of franchise systems and help protect both franchisors and franchisees.

Retailers, restaurants, and hospitality companies face a growing array of regulatory requirements. We provide counsel on licensing, vendor contracts, food and beverage regulations, consumer protection laws, and data privacy standards.
